Going to add this to OP: (way2g00)

Got it.

1.-Kill zombies (30+) only with the Retriever in the GG Bridge.

2.-Return to the island and throw it to the hell portal or whatever.

3.-Wait a round, and go to the tomohawk spawn point in afterlife mode.

4.-Grab it.

It's stronger, I think you throw it faster, you can power-it up 3 times instead of 2, and... its blue! :D

Hope this helps.

The first guy did not mention killing them on the bridge also where do you have to be located to throw it in, I put myself to the right of the dog head emplacement and I could not throw it in.

Also I think I heard a noise after killing a couple zombie with the tomahawk is there supposed to be a noise like with the spoon sacrifice?? (Demonic Laugh)

Believe me. You MUST kill zombies in the bridge, if you don't the Tomohawk will not stay on the portal.

Once you get the kills, throw it from the fences in front of the dog, it's pretty easy and you have a perfect line of sight.

About the laugh, I thought it would be, but no. It looks like there's no way to know when you are done, just try it every time you return from the bridge.
